S Froshauer is a scholar working on Molecular Biology, Ecology and Microbiology. According to data from OpenAlex, S Froshauer has authored 14 papers receiving a total of 955 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 5 papers in Ecology and 4 papers in Microbiology. Recurrent topics in S Froshauer's work include Bacteriophages and microbial interactions (5 papers), Microbial infections and disease research (4 papers) and RNA and protein synthesis mechanisms (4 papers). S Froshauer is often cited by papers focused on Bacteriophages and microbial interactions (5 papers), Microbial infections and disease research (4 papers) and RNA and protein synthesis mechanisms (4 papers). S Froshauer collaborates with scholars based in United States. S Froshauer's co-authors include Ari Helenius, Jürgen Kartenbeck, J Beckwith, Dermot McGovern, Harvey F. Lodish, Michael R. Botchan, Ahmad I. Bukhari, George M. Weinstock, Monjula Chidambaram and Scott J. Hecker and has published in prestigious journals such as Nature, Journal of Biological Chemistry and The Journal of Cell Biology.
